Spring Roof Covering Maintenance



When springtime shows up, it's vital to check your roof covering for any kind of damage or wear that may have taken place throughout the winter season. Beginning by examining the tiles for any type of signs of fracturing, curling, or missing out on pieces. These could indicate water damage or aging shingles that require changing.

Look for any kind of loosened or broken blinking around smokeshafts, vents, and skylights, as these can bring about leaks if not effectively sealed.

Clear out rain gutters and downspouts from debris like fallen leaves and branches to make sure appropriate drain and prevent water accumulation on the roofing.

Cut any looming branches that could potentially damage your roofing system throughout strong winds or tornados.

Last but not least, check out the attic room for signs of water spots, mold and mildew, or mildew, as these might show a leak in your roofing system.

Summer Season Roofing Care



Throughout the summer season, keeping your roof is necessary to guarantee it endures the warm and potential weather difficulties. Start by clearing any kind of debris like fallen leaves, branches, and dust from the roofing surface area and seamless gutters.

The scorching sun can create tiles to warp or crack, so inspect them for any damages and replace as required. Check for indicators of algae or moss development, particularly in shaded locations, and tidy them to prevent wetness retention.



Cut overhanging tree branches to prevent them scrubing versus the roofing system during summer season tornados. Additionally, evaluate the flashing around smokeshafts, vents, and skylights for any kind of spaces or damage that could bring about leakages.

Take into consideration using a reflective finish to decrease heat absorption and minimize energy costs during hot months. On a regular basis checking and maintaining your roofing system in the summer season will certainly help extend its lifespan and ensure it safeguards your home efficiently.
